CBS To Combine Syndication Arms CBS Paramount, King World

By Rafat Ali - Tue 26 Sep 2006 03:11 PM PST

CBS has formed the CBS Television Distribution Group to handle its a worldwide production, distribution and media sales, combining the resources of CBS Paramount Domestic Television, King World and CBS Paramount International Television into one.
King World CEO Roger King has been named CEO of the new group. Robert Madden and John Nogawski each are president and COO, with Armando Nunnez Jr. continuing as president of CBS Paramount International Television. Nogawski will also look after new media distribution.
